Tom HalversenSellConviction3/5Analysis quality55/1001

The YouTuber recommends avoiding Lordstown Motors, citing its low revenue and uncertainty about achieving positive cash flow despite having some cash on hand. He questions the viability of its business model, especially given the current market environment where investors are less willing to fund unprofitable EV companies indefinitely.

Investing GroveBuyConviction4/5Analysis quality70/1001

The YouTuber views Lordstown Motors as a high-risk, high-reward short squeeze candidate, despite recent negative news and an SEC investigation. He notes the stock is down 72% from its peak and believes that if the company can secure funding or a strategic partner to begin production, the shares could pop significantly, especially given that 60% of shares are institutionally owned, providing some support.
